Goats Cheese & Cherry Salad with Honey & Thyme Dressing

Cherry & Goats Cheese Salad with Honey & Thyme Dressing contains plenty of crunch, plus dreamy creaminess and a good fruity bite. It’s summer on a plate and so easy to assemble.
Prep Time5 minutes
Cook Time0 minutes
Total Time5 minutes
Course: lunch, Salad
Cuisine: Worldwide
Servings: 2

Ingredients

For the Salad

  • 1 Head Romaine Lettuce (or other sweet & crunchy lettuce)
  • 12 Cherries
  • 60 g/ 2 oz Goats cheese
  • 12 Almonds (blanched)
  • 12 Hazelnuts (blanched)
  • 2 Radish
  • 1 Pot salad cress

For the Dressing

  • 2 tablespoon Olive oil
  • 2 teaspoon White wine v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on Honey
  • 2 teaspoon Fresh thyme leaves
  • Salt & pepper

Instructions

  • Wash the salad leaves and pat dry on a clean tea towel
  • Rip up the large ones and scatter over 2 serving plates
  • Thinly slice the radish and divide between the plates
  • Cut the cress and scatter over the leaves
  • Cut the cherries in half, remove the stones and divide between the plates along with the nuts
  • Slice the goats cheese and use to top the salads
  • Put the dressing ingredients into a small jug and blend. Season to taste, then drizzle over the salad
  • Serve immediately
